Postfix Konfiguration

godi

New Member
Hi all.

Ich habe ein sehr komisches Problem.

Ich habe auf meinem Web-Server ein Postfix eingerichtet.
(Sys = debian Etch, mit VHCS)
(Mehrere Domains werden verwendet = dom1.net und dom2.de)

Zu erst konnte ich keine E-Mails an gmx Konten schicken.
Das Problem habe ich gelöst in dem ich den myhostname und mydomain auf dom1.net gestellt habe

E-Mails wurden an gmx gesendet. Nun habe ich jedoch das Problem: Wenn ich E-Mails an dom1.net schicke, kommen die nicht mehr an sondern werden zurückgewiesen.
Wenn ich jedoch eine E-Mail an dom2.de schicke, kommt diese an.

Kann mir einer helfen?

Thx
 
In der Log steht zu der E-Mail die er Empfangen soll:
Jan 28 13:02:29 Debian-40-etch-64-LAMP postfix/smtpd[8105]: connect from mail.bildungscentrum.de[62.225.8.78]
Jan 28 13:02:30 Debian-40-etch-64-LAMP postfix/trivial-rewrite[8107]: warning: do not list domain pressrecord.net in BOTH mydestination and virtual_mailbox_domains
Jan 28 13:02:30 Debian-40-etch-64-LAMP postfix/smtpd[8105]: 07B601030721: client=mail.bildungscentrum.de[62.225.8.78]
Jan 28 13:02:30 Debian-40-etch-64-LAMP postfix/cleanup[8108]: 07B601030721: message-id=<D370B6CF5887B143AFB11AFFC298D9AE011B3493@ms-e-verw-ex01.bcw-intern.local>
Jan 28 13:02:30 Debian-40-etch-64-LAMP postfix/qmgr[7047]: 07B601030721: from=<marcel.naujoks@bcw-gruppe.de>, size=4897, nrcpt=1 (queue active)
Jan 28 13:02:30 Debian-40-etch-64-LAMP postfix/trivial-rewrite[8107]: warning: do not list domain pressrecord.net in BOTH mydestination and virtual_mailbox_domains
Jan 28 13:02:30 Debian-40-etch-64-LAMP postfix/local[8109]: warning: dict_nis_init: NIS domain name not set - NIS lookups disabled
Jan 28 13:02:30 Debian-40-etch-64-LAMP postfix/smtpd[8105]: disconnect from mail.bildungscentrum.de[62.225.8.78]
Jan 28 13:02:30 Debian-40-etch-64-LAMP postfix/local[8109]: 07B601030721: to=<marcel@pressrecord.net>, relay=local, delay=0.1, delays=0.08/0.01/0/0.02, dsn=5.1.1, status=bounced (unknown user: "marcel")
Jan 28 13:02:30 Debian-40-etch-64-LAMP postfix/cleanup[8108]: 1E870103089D: message-id=<20080128120230.1E870103089D@pressrecord.net>
Jan 28 13:02:30 Debian-40-etch-64-LAMP postfix/qmgr[7047]: 1E870103089D: from=<>, size=6671, nrcpt=1 (queue active)
Jan 28 13:02:30 Debian-40-etch-64-LAMP postfix/bounce[8111]: 07B601030721: sender non-delivery notification: 1E870103089D
Jan 28 13:02:30 Debian-40-etch-64-LAMP postfix/qmgr[7047]: 07B601030721: removed
Jan 28 13:02:30 Debian-40-etch-64-LAMP postfix/smtp[8112]: 1E870103089D: to=<marcel.naujoks@bcw-gruppe.de>, relay=mail.bildungscentrum.de[62.225.8.78]:25, delay=0.17, delays=0.02/0.01/0.05/0.09, dsn=2.0.0, status=sent (250 NAA31705 Message accepted for delivery)
Jan 28 13:02:30 Debian-40-etch-64-LAMP postfix/qmgr[7047]: 1E870103089D: removed
Jan 28 13:05:50 Debian-40-etch-64-LAMP postfix/anvil[8106]: statistics: max connection rate 1/60s for (smtp:62.225.8.78) at Jan 28 13:02:29
Jan 28 13:05:50 Debian-40-etch-64-LAMP postfix/anvil[8106]: statistics: max connection count 1 for (smtp:62.225.8.78) at Jan 28 13:02:29
Jan 28 13:05:50 Debian-40-etch-64-LAMP postfix/anvil[8106]: statistics: max cache size 1 at Jan 28 13:02:29
Jan 28 13:10:22 Debian-40-etch-64-LAMP postfix/qmgr[7047]: 0CF0A103085D: from=<marcel@pressrecord.net>, size=799, nrcpt=2 (queue active)
Jan 28 13:10:22 Debian-40-etch-64-LAMP postfix/qmgr[7047]: 7696A1030723: from=<marcel@pressrecord.net>, size=1352, nrcpt=1 (queue active)
Jan 28 13:10:22 Debian-40-etch-64-LAMP postfix/smtp[8156]: 0CF0A103085D: host mx-ha01.web.de[217.72.192.149] refused to talk to me: 554 Transaction failed. For explanation visit FreeMail von WEB.DE
Jan 28 13:10:22 Debian-40-etch-64-LAMP postfix/smtp[8157]: 7696A1030723: host mx-ha01.web.de[217.72.192.149] refused to talk to me: 554 Transaction failed. For explanation visit FreeMail von WEB.DE
Jan 28 13:10:22 Debian-40-etch-64-LAMP postfix/smtp[8156]: 0CF0A103085D: to=<manapage@web.de>, relay=mx-ha02.web.de[217.72.192.188]:25, delay=13213, delays=13213/0.03/0.1/0, dsn=4.0.0, status=deferred (host mx-ha02.web.de[217.72.192.188] refused to talk to me: 554 Transaction failed. For explanation visit FreeMail von WEB.DE)
Jan 28 13:10:22 Debian-40-etch-64-LAMP postfix/smtp[8157]: 7696A1030723: to=<manapage@web.de>, relay=mx-ha02.web.de[217.72.192.188]:25, delay=60618, delays=60618/0.01/0.1/0, dsn=4.0.0, status=deferred (host mx-ha02.web.de[217.72.192.188] refused to talk to me: 554 Transaction failed. For explanation visit FreeMail von WEB.DE)
 
Das Problem habe ich gelöst in dem ich den myhostname und mydomain auf dom1.net gestellt habe

Dabei hast Du allerdings vergessen, den PTR-Record (->PowerReverse im ControlPanel) auch auf den Hostnamen zu setzen. Damit Mail funktioniert muss immer folgendes Bedingung gelten: A->PTR->A. Die anderen Tipps, die der von web.de angegebene Link enthält kannst Du mit entsprechenden Tools (->Forensuche) bei Gelegenheit auch mal testen.

Ansonsten steht ja recht deutlich im Logfile, dass Du eine Domain (in /etc/postfix/main.cf) sowohl bei mydestination als auch in virtual_mailbox_domains (von VHCS verwaltet) eingetragen hast. Bei mydestination sollte nur die Domain stehen, die nicht über VHCS verwaltet werden (z.B. der Rechnername). Insofern war es vielleicht nicht so klug, myhostname und mydomain auf dom1.net zu setzen, falls diese Domain auch mit VHCS verwaltet wird und damit automatisch in den virtual_mailbox_domains auftaucht.

Viele Grüße,
LinuxAdmin

PS: Was in myhostname drin steht ist letztendlich egal, solange der Hostname einen gültigen A-Record im DNS besitzt, der wiederum auf eine IP-Adresse lautetet, deren PTR-Record wieder auf diesen A-Record zeigt (s.o.). Den genauen Inhalt sieht normalerweise kein Mensch. Allerdings sollte man darauf achten, dass der Name nicht zu sehr wie static.88-198-6-40.clients.your-server.de. aussieht, da manche Filter (s. web.de-Link) das als dynamische Adresse identifizieren könnten (obwohl vorne static steht).
 
Back
Top